ANGELWAX Ark Marine Neptune Heavy Cut Compound

Angelwax Neptune is an extra heavy cut compound with maximum paint correction that is less dusty than other polishing pastes. The Angelwax Ultra Heavy Compound is called a grinding paste because it allows you to repair damaged paint by polishing. Use this polishing paste with a super heavy cut polishing pad or wool polishing wheel to remove deep scratches and swirls on gelcoat and fiberglass.

Angelwax Marine Super Heavy Cut Compound

Angelwax Ultra Heavy Compound is specially designed to polish modern and hard gelcoats. Boats with hard clear coats are difficult to polish. With this Super Heavy Cut polishing compound from Angelwax, you can polish effectively allowing you to quickly remove scratches on the boat and repair paint defects.

Use a finishing polish

Due to the extremely high paint correction, after polishing with this polishing compound, it is necessary to treat the boat with a finishing polish in a second step. This polish removes the haze, superficial scratches and swirls from the gelcoat giving the paint maximum shine and depth!
